  • Patent number: 6662892
    Abstract: An air intake for a motorized vehicle, for obtaining a low radar and IR signature of a ballistically protected air intake (10) of the vehicle. The air intake (10) has a perforated armour plate (12) lying level with an outer bodywork plate (14) of the vehicle, and a fresh-air duct (18) which adjoins the inside of the perforated armour plate (12) and which has a fan (20) for sucking the fresh air necessary for running the vehicle into the duct via air intake openings (16) in the armour plate. A wall section (22) of the fresh-air duct (18) situated between the air intake openings (16) and a heat-generating source (24) in the vehicle is air-cooled.

  • Patent number: 6385968
    Abstract: The invention concerns an arrangement for a discharge system for combustion gases from a motor-driven vehicle which gives the vehicle a low IR signature. According to the invention, the gas outflow channel (28), at least in an area of the channel adjacent to the discharge aperture (32), has a boundary wall (34) which is perforated right up to the open discharge aperture (32) and surrounded by a cooling air channel (38). The arrangement is such that cooling air can sweep over the inner side as well as the outer side of the perforated wall (34).
